Unacademy founders’ shift to AirLearn, Jain’s offline role are strategic: Gaurav Munjal to employees

  • Unacademy cofounders Gaurav Munjal and Roman Saini are dedicating substantial time and resources to AirLearn, a new language learning platform, while Sumit Jain is focusing on strengthening the company's offline business.
  • Munjal mentioned that their increased involvement in AirLearn and Jain's concentration on the offline business are strategic moves aligned with Unacademy's long-term goals.
  • Discussions about Munjal's potential exit from Unacademy due to his lack of interest in running an offline coaching business have been ongoing for more than a year. The terms of the founders' departure, including a cash payout and retaining equity, are currently being negotiated.
  • Unacademy is reassuring its staff that despite the founders' changes in roles, the company is performing well with reduced burn rate and a healthy balance sheet, as per Munjal's email to employees.
